β¦ Synopsis
The structures and damping characteristics of the NiTi shape memory alloy using different heat treatment methods have been clarified by X-ray diffraction, differential scanning calorimetry, and damping analysis. Especially, we studied the dependence of damping characteristics on temperature, and the relations between vibration frequency and the transformation of the material. The results show that the structure of the alloy with slow cooling consists of large amounts of the M and R phases, and the Ni-richer Ti 3 Ni 4 , so that the damping level of the alloy is higher and produce a low frequency damping peak in the temperature area corresponding to the M β R reverse transformation in the reheating process. It is of technological importance.
